Stock Track | Dutch Bros Plunges 6.03% in Pre-Market After Q1 Earnings Miss

Dutch Bros Inc. shares fell sharply by 6.03% in pre-market trading on Thursday, extending losses from the previous session following the release of the company's first-quarter financial results.

The coffee chain reported quarterly earnings of 13 cents per share, which missed the consensus analyst estimate of 15 cents per share. While the company's revenue of $464.4 million exceeded expectations of $449.6 million, the earnings shortfall appears to have disappointed investors who had driven the stock up 12.9% during the quarter leading up to the report.

Analyst sentiment had shown signs of caution ahead of the earnings release, with the mean earnings estimate falling by approximately 12.4% over the previous three months and three analysts negatively revising their estimates in the last 30 days. The mixed analyst reactions following the report, including both target price increases and decreases, reflect ongoing uncertainty about the company's near-term prospects.
